//
// is_blackbox
//
// Checks the JsonNode for an attributes dictionary, with a "blackbox" entry.
// An item is deemed to be a blackbox if this entry exists and if its
// value is not zero.  If the item is a black box, this routine will return
// true, false otherwise
bool is_blackbox(JsonNode *node)
{
    JsonNode *attr_node, *bbox_node;

    if (node->data_dict.count("attributes") == 0)
        return false;
    attr_node = node->data_dict.at("attributes");
    if (attr_node == NULL)
        return false;
    if (attr_node->type != 'D')
        return false;
    if (GetSize(attr_node->data_dict) == 0)
        return false;
    if (attr_node->data_dict.count("blackbox") == 0)
        return false;
    bbox_node = attr_node->data_dict.at("blackbox");
    if (bbox_node == NULL)
        return false;
    if (bbox_node->type != 'N')
        log_error("JSON module blackbox is not a number\n");
    if (bbox_node->data_number == 0)
        return false;
    return true;
}

void json_import(Context *ctx, string modname, JsonNode *node)
{
    if (is_blackbox(node))
        return;

    log_info("Importing module %s\n", modname.c_str());

    // Multiple labels might refer to the same net. For now we resolve conflicts thus:
    //  - names with fewer $ are always prefered
    //  - between equal $ counts, fewer .s are prefered
    //  - ties are resolved alphabetically
    auto prefer_netlabel = [](const std::string &a, const std::string &b) {
        if (b.empty())
            return true;
        long a_dollars = std::count(a.begin(), a.end(), '$'), b_dollars = std::count(b.begin(), b.end(), '$');
        if (a_dollars < b_dollars)
            return true;
        else if (a_dollars > b_dollars)
            return false;
        long a_dots = std::count(a.begin(), a.end(), '.'), b_dots = std::count(b.begin(), b.end(), '.');
        if (a_dots < b_dots)
            return true;
        else if (a_dots > b_dots)
            return false;
        return a < b;
    };

    // Import netnames
    std::vector<std::string> netlabels;
    if (node->data_dict.count("netnames")) {
        JsonNode *cell_parent = node->data_dict.at("netnames");
        for (int nnid = 0; nnid < GetSize(cell_parent->data_dict_keys); nnid++) {
            JsonNode *here;

            here = cell_parent->data_dict.at(cell_parent->data_dict_keys[nnid]);
            std::string basename = cell_parent->data_dict_keys[nnid];
            if (here->data_dict.count("bits")) {
                JsonNode *bits = here->data_dict.at("bits");
                assert(bits->type == 'A');
                size_t num_bits = bits->data_array.size();
                for (size_t i = 0; i < num_bits; i++) {
                    int netid = bits->data_array.at(i)->data_number;
                    if (netid >= int(netlabels.size()))
                        netlabels.resize(netid + 1);
                    std::string name =
                            basename + (num_bits == 1 ? "" : std::string("[") + std::to_string(i) + std::string("]"));
                    if (prefer_netlabel(name, netlabels.at(netid)))
                        netlabels.at(netid) = name;
                }
            }
        }
    }
    std::vector<IdString> netids;
    std::transform(netlabels.begin(), netlabels.end(), std::back_inserter(netids),
                   [ctx](const std::string &s) { return ctx->id(s); });
